Unhappy Speaker buzz/crackling... Burning smell

Hi guys, I posted this at bimmerfest too, hoping that I could get some more help/info on this...

Okay... so I'm driving yesterday in the crappy rain we've had here in Southern California. The speakers start popping and crackling. Then I smell something like burning plastic. Changing the radio station results in a noticeably long delay. Audio seemed tinny as well. At first I thought it was just a blown speaker (why, I have no idea as I don't play the music very loud), so I turned it off. The crackling was still there; it seemed like it was coming from the left driver speaker, bluetooth mic area, and rear passenger side speakers. It buzzed once at a very loud volume. The burning smell was pretty nasty and gave me a terrible headache. I took it straight to the dealer. I'm still waiting for a call back from my SA.

Anyone else notice this? Maybe something due to the rain?
